Abstract

This study presented the 1st conversion power performance evaluation of the floating wave energy converter considering the two-body system and the three-dimensional analysis and the time-domain numerical simulation. The comparison of the 1st conversion power performance between the one-body system and the two-body system in the one-dimensional simulation was also presented. The reactive control strategy was employed and the performance of the two-body system indicated the interesting character. The optimal control parameters those were calculated in the one-dimensional simulation were applied to the three-dimensional simulation and the result of the three-dimensional simulation was presented by comparing with the one-dimensional simulation.
